22 Rowarth Avenue, Kesgrave, Ipswich, IP5 2FL is a freehold detached property built between 1991-1995. The property offers approximately 1,679 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have five b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£502,121 , which equates to approximately £299 per square foot. It was last sold on 21 Jan 2025 for £500,000. Since then, the value has increased by £2,121, representing a 0.4% increase, or approximately 0.5% per year.

22 Rowarth Avenue, Kesgrave, Ipswich, East Suffolk, Suffolk, IP5 2FL has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 17 Apr 2019.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 9 Sep 2014, and the property received the same rating of D with an unchanged energy efficiency score of 67.
